Applicants must demonstrate English proficiency through recognized tests such as IELTS (minimum 6.5 overall), TOEFL (minimum 90 iBT), or equivalent certifications. Proof of medium of instruction in English during previous studies may also be accepted. Strong communication skills are essential due to the program’s technical and collaborative nature.

International students must obtain a student visa to study in Poland. The visa application requires a valid passport, admission letter from Warsaw University of Technology, proof of financial means, health insurance, and accommodation details. The process typically takes up to 30 days. Students should apply at the nearest Polish consulate or embassy. Maintaining valid visa status during studies is essential, with options to extend if needed. Compliance with local regulations and university requirements is mandatory.
Indian students admitted to the Robotics program must apply for a Polish student visa (D-type) to study in Poland. The visa application requires an official admission letter, valid passport, proof of sufficient funds (around 10,000 PLN per month), health insurance coverage, and accommodation details. Processing times can range from 2 to 4 weeks. It is advisable to apply well in advance to ensure timely arrival. During the stay, students must register with local authorities and comply with visa conditions for duration and work permissions.
